package org.apache.hadoop.yarn.server.webapp;
import static org.apache.hadoop.yarn.util.StringHelper.join;
import static org.apache.hadoop.yarn.webapp.YarnWebParams.APPLICATION_ATTEMPT_ID;
import java.io.IOException;
import java.util.Collection;
import org.apache.commons.lang.StringEscapeUtils;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;
import org.apache.hadoop.yarn.api.records.ApplicationAttemptId;
import org.apache.hadoop.yarn.api.records.ApplicationAttemptReport;
import org.apache.hadoop.yarn.api.records.ContainerReport;
import org.apache.hadoop.yarn.server.api.ApplicationContext;
import org.apache.hadoop.yarn.server.webapp.dao.AppAttemptInfo;
import org.apache.hadoop.yarn.server.webapp.dao.ContainerInfo;
import org.apache.hadoop.yarn.util.ConverterUtils;
import org.apache.hadoop.yarn.webapp.hamlet.Hamlet;
import org.apache.hadoop.yarn.webapp.hamlet.Hamlet.TABLE;
import org.apache.hadoop.yarn.webapp.hamlet.Hamlet.TBODY;
import org.apache.hadoop.yarn.webapp.view.HtmlBlock;
import org.apache.hadoop.yarn.webapp.view.InfoBlock;
import com.google.inject.Inject;
public class AppAttemptBlock extends HtmlBlock {
private static final Log LOG = LogFactory.getLog(AppAttemptBlock.class);
private final ApplicationContext appContext;
@Inject
public AppAttemptBlock(ApplicationContext appContext) {
this.appContext = appContext;
}
@Override
protected void render(Block html) {
String attemptid = $(APPLICATION_ATTEMPT_ID);
if (attemptid.isEmpty()) {
puts("Bad request: requires application attempt ID");
return;
}
ApplicationAttemptId appAttemptId = null;
try {
appAttemptId = ConverterUtils.toApplicationAttemptId(attemptid);
} catch (IllegalArgumentException e) {
puts("Invalid application attempt ID: " + attemptid);
return;
}
ApplicationAttemptReport appAttemptReport;
try {
appAttemptReport = appContext.getApplicationAttempt(appAttemptId);
} catch (IOException e) {
String message =
"Failed to read the application attempt " + appAttemptId + ".";
LOG.error(message, e);
html.p()._(message)._();
return;
}
if (appAttemptReport == null) {
puts("Application Attempt not found: " + attemptid);
return;
}
AppAttemptInfo appAttempt = new AppAttemptInfo(appAttemptReport);
setTitle(join("Application Attempt ", attemptid));
String node = "N/A";
if (appAttempt.getHost() != null && appAttempt.getRpcPort() >= 0
&& appAttempt.getRpcPort() < 65536) {
node = appAttempt.getHost() + ":" + appAttempt.getRpcPort();
}
info("Application Attempt Overview")
._("State", appAttempt.getAppAttemptState())
._(
"Master Container",
appAttempt.getAmContainerId() == null ? "#" : root_url("container",
appAttempt.getAmContainerId()),
String.valueOf(appAttempt.getAmContainerId()))
._("Node:", node)
._(
"Tracking URL:",
appAttempt.getTrackingUrl() == null ? "#" : root_url(appAttempt
.getTrackingUrl()), "History")
._("Diagnostics Info:", appAttempt.getDiagnosticsInfo());
html._(InfoBlock.class);
Collection<ContainerReport> containers;
try {
containers = appContext.getContainers(appAttemptId).values();
} catch (IOException e) {
html
.p()
._(
"Sorry, Failed to get containers for application attempt" + attemptid
+ ".")._();
return;
}
// Container Table
TBODY<TABLE<Hamlet>> tbody =
html.table("#containers").thead().tr().th(".id", "Container ID")
.th(".node", "Node").th(".exitstatus", "Container Exit Status")
.th(".logs", "Logs")._()._().tbody();
StringBuilder containersTableData = new StringBuilder("[\n");
for (ContainerReport containerReport : containers) {
ContainerInfo container = new ContainerInfo(containerReport);
// ConatinerID numerical value parsed by parseHadoopID in
// yarn.dt.plugins.js
containersTableData
.append("[\"<a href='")
.append(url("container", container.getContainerId()))
.append("'>")
.append(container.getContainerId())
.append("</a>\",\"<a href='")
.append(container.getAssignedNodeId())
.append("'>")
.append(
StringEscapeUtils.escapeJavaScript(StringEscapeUtils
.escapeHtml(container.getAssignedNodeId()))).append("</a>\",\"")
.append(container.getContainerExitStatus()).append("\",\"<a href='")
.append(container.getLogUrl() == null ?
"#" : container.getLogUrl()).append("'>")
.append(container.getLogUrl() == null ?
"N/A" : "Logs").append("</a>\"],\n");
}
if (containersTableData.charAt(containersTableData.length() - 2) == ',') {
containersTableData.delete(containersTableData.length() - 2,
containersTableData.length() - 1);
}
containersTableData.append("]");
html.script().$type("text/javascript")
._("var containersTableData=" + containersTableData)._();
tbody._()._();
}
}
